
Call Center Nurse Registered Nurse
At UnitedHealth Group, we believe in providing quality healthcare to our members through exceptional customer service. As a Call Center Nurse Registered Nurse, you will play a crucial role in delivering compassionate and timely care to our members over the phone. We are seeking a highly motivated and professional individual with a passion for helping others. If you have excellent communication skills, a strong clinical background, and a desire to make a positive impact on people's lives, we invite you to join our team.
- Conduct phone consultations with members to assess their healthcare needs and provide appropriate medical advice and guidance.
- Utilize clinical knowledge and expertise to accurately triage and prioritize member calls.
- Provide compassionate and empathetic customer service to members, ensuring their concerns and needs are addressed.
- Document all interactions and interventions in a timely and accurate manner.
- Collaborate with other healthcare professionals to ensure continuity of care and appropriate follow-up for members.
- Stay current on healthcare policies, procedures, and regulations to ensure compliance.
- Identify and escalate urgent or emergent situations to the appropriate medical personnel.
- Maintain confidentiality of all member information and adhere to HIPAA regulations.
- Utilize critical thinking and problem-solving skills to effectively address member concerns and resolve issues.
- Participate in ongoing training and development to enhance clinical knowledge and skills.
- Act as a resource for other team members and provide support and guidance as needed.
- Proactively identify and communicate potential areas for improvement in processes and procedures.
- Adhere to company policies and procedures, including attendance and performance standards.
- Maintain a positive and professional attitude and demeanor at all times.
- Demonstrate a commitment to providing exceptional customer service and promoting a positive image of UnitedHealth Group.

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Call Center Nurse Registered Nurse in Dallas, TX, USA is approximately $60,000 to $80,000 per year. This can vary depending on factors such as experience, qualifications, and the specific company or organization the nurse is employed with. Some nurses in this role may also receive additional benefits such as health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off.

UnitedHealth Group Incorporated is an American for-profit managed health care company based in Minnetonka, Minnesota. UnitedHealth Group, Inc. provides health care coverage, software and data consultancy services. It operates through the following segments: UnitedHealthcare, OptumHealth, OptumInsight, and OptumRx. The UnitedHealthcare segment utilizes Optum's capabilities to help coordinate patient care, improve affordability of medical care, analyze cost trends, manage pharmacy benefits, work with care providers more effectively, and create a simpler consumer experience.
